Как создать бота для чата в Telegram
В наше время мессенджеры стали неотъемлемой частью нашей повседневной жизни. Они позволяют нам общаться, делиться информацией и получать уведомления сразу на наши мобильные устройства; Одним из самых популярных мессенджеров является Telegram, который также предоставляет возможность создания собственных ботов.
Бот – это автоматизированный собеседник, способный отвечать на определенные команды и выполнять определенные функции. Они широко используются в самых разных сферах – от образования и развлечений до бизнеса и технической поддержки.
Создание бота в Telegram
Для создания бота в Telegram необходимо выполнить несколько простых шагов⁚
- Откройте приложение Telegram и найдите в нем бота @BotFather.
- Начните диалог с ботом @BotFather и следуйте его инструкциям. Он поможет вам создать нового бота и даст вам токен, который будет использоваться для управления вашим ботом.
- Сохраните полученный токен, он будет использоваться для настройки вашего бота.
Программирование бота
После создания бота в Telegram необходимо написать программу, которая будет управлять им. Существует несколько популярных библиотек и языков программирования, которые предназначены для разработки ботов в Telegram.
Python – один из самых популярных языков программирования для создания ботов в Telegram. Для программирования бота на Python существует библиотека python-telegram-bot, которая предоставляет удобный интерфейс для взаимодействия с API Telegram.
Node.js – еще один популярный язык программирования, который можно использовать для создания ботов в Telegram. Для работы с API Telegram в Node.js можно использовать библиотеку node-telegram-bot-api.
Java, Ruby, PHP, C# – это также популярные языки программирования, которые поддерживают создание ботов в Telegram. Для каждого из этих языков существуют соответствующие библиотеки для работы с API Telegram.
Функции и команды бота
После того, как вы выбрали язык программирования и подключили соответствующую библиотеку, вы можете начать разрабатывать функциональность своего бота. Боты в Telegram могут выполнять различные задачи, в зависимости от их предназначения.
Примеры функций, которые вы можете реализовать в своем боте⁚
- Отправка сообщений пользователям.
- Получение информации от пользователя через команды.
- Отправка уведомлений и обновлений пользователю.
- Интерактивная обработка данных и ответы на запросы пользователей.
В зависимости от языка программирования и библиотеки, которую вы используете, существуют различные способы реализации каждой из этих функций. Документация к библиотеке, которую вы выбрали, будет содержать подробную информацию о том, как использовать различные функции и команды, чтобы создать интерактивного бота для Telegram.
Интеграция бота в чат
Когда ваш бот полностью разработан и готов к использованию, вы можете интегрировать его в чаты в Telegram. Для этого вам необходимо добавить созданного бота в группу или в личный чат.
Для добавления бота в чат необходимо перейти в настройки чата и выбрать пункт ″Добавить участника″. В поле поиска введите имя вашего бота и выберите его из списка предложенных пользователей. После этого ваш бот будет добавлен в чат и будет готов к использованию.
Теперь, когда ваш бот добавлен в чат, пользователи смогут обращаться к нему и использовать его функции и команды. Бот будет отвечать на сообщения и выполнять заданные функции в зависимости от введенных команд.
Создание бота для чата в Telegram – это увлекательный и полезный процесс. Боты могут выполнять множество функций и быть полезными инструментами для общения, управления информацией и автоматизации задач. Используя различные языки программирования и библиотеки, вы можете создавать интерактивных и уникальных ботов, которые будут отвечать потребностям ваших пользователей.
Так что не стесняйтесь – создайте своего собственного бота для чата в Telegram и наслаждайтесь общением с вашими пользователями!